Process for Obtaining a Belgian Driver's License Without a Test
Here is a step-by-step breakdown of the process to exchange a foreign license for a Belgian one without a driving test:
Step 1: Verify Eligibility
Make sure that your foreign motorist's license is valid and falls under the categories accepted for exchange. EU licenses and those from particular countries with reciprocal agreements are usually accepted.
Step 2: Gather Required Documents
Assemble the necessary paperwork to support your application, which usually consists of:

Check out the local municipality (commune) where you reside and send your application in addition to all needed documents. Depending on the municipality, the process may differ, and you may need to set a visit ahead of time.
Step 4: Pay the Fees
Pay the appropriate costs associated with the license exchange. Fees can differ by municipality, so it's crucial to validate the quantity in advance.
Step 5: Receive Your Belgian License
When the application is processed and authorized, you will get your Belgian motorist's license without the need to finish a driving test.
Frequently asked questions About Obtaining a Belgian License Without a TestQ1: Can I exchange my motorist's license from a non-EU nation?
A: Yes, but only if Belgium has a mutual arrangement with that nation. Nations such as the USA, Canada, and Australia have varying policies, so it is important to inspect the specifics before proceeding.
Q2: How long does the exchange process take?
A: The timeframe can vary depending upon the town however generally takes between 1 to 4 weeks once the application is sent.
Q3: Are there any age restrictions for exchanging my license?
A: No specific age constraints exist for exchanging a legitimate foreign license for a Belgian one, but additional requirements might apply if you are over the age of 65.
Q4: What should I do if I lost my foreign chauffeur's license?
A: If your foreign license is lost, you will need to obtain a replacement from the releasing authority in your house nation before you can get the Belgian license.
Q5: Is there a possibility of being needed to take a test anyway?
A: While many exchanges are uncomplicated, authorities may request a test if there are doubts about your driving ability based on your paperwork or driving history.
